Python简介及环境安装
Python
官网传送门
Python是一种面向对象的解释性计算机程序设计语言。
Python 2.7将于2020年1月1日终止支持,本笔记基于Python3。
pip
pip 是一个现代的,通用的 Python 包管理工具。提供了对 Python 包的查找、下载、安装、卸载的功能。
pip安装包:pip install requests
pip卸载包:pip uninstall requests
pip升级包:pip install --upgrade requests
查看更新包:pip list --outdated
查看安装包:pip show --files requests
Python环境安装
Mac下自带安装了Python2.7,但没有安装pip2。通过再次用brew安装pyhton2后就自动安装了pip2
安装python2和pip2:brew install python@2
测试python2安装结果:python -V
查看pip2版本:pip2 -V
安装python3和pip3: brew install python
测试python2安装结果:python3 -V
查看pip3版本:pip3 -V
如果报错:Permission denied @ dir_s_mkdir - /usr/local/Frameworks,则新建文件夹并授予权限
sudo mkdir /usr/local/Frameworks
sudo chown $(whoami):admin /usr/local/Frameworks
brew link python
如果安装完python3仍然没有pip3,则下载脚本并执行
wget https://bootstrap.pypa.io/get-pip.py
python3 get-pip.py
ln -s /usr/local/Cellar/python/3.7.0/Frameworks/Python.framework/Versions/3.7/bin/pip3 /usr/local/bin/
最新文章
- APP开发+发布流程
- mysql启动报错The server quit without updating PID file
- 【转载】Android 自动化测试 Emmagee
- 网页制作过程中div定位的三个问题
- C# 调用 WebService 连接ORACLE 11g
- 在客户端缓存Servlet的输出
- Bzoj 4950
- RabbitMQ CLI 管理工具 rabbitmqadmin(管理和监控)
- Web开发人员学习路线图
- C#中 Reference Equals, == , Equals的区别
- java.lang.ClassCastException:java.util.LinkedHashMap不能转换为com.testing.models.Account
- linux压缩与解压
- centos7安装配置mysql5.6
- Effective Java 第三版——45. 明智审慎地使用Stream
- Install jdk on Ubuntu16
- Unity中UGUI之Canvas属性解读版本二
- 《图解HTTP》读书笔记(转)
- win7运行bat文件 一闪而过 解决 必须要将生成器放在C盘等没有中文的目录里
- 以太坊博弈游戏 -- FOMO3D,讽刺人性
- jenkins 使用的python 不是指定的python 的解决方法